AMC's Thorsten Kaye returns to NHL.com for Stanley Cup Playoffs
NHL.com, the official website of the National Hockey League and the leading online community for hockey fans, once again will feature exclusive blogs written by celebrities from television, movies and music during the Stanley Cup™ Playoffs. For the third straight year, celebrity fans will share their love of hockey, impressions of their favorite team's performance and their predictions, all while giving fans a glimpse inside their worlds.

Thorsten Kaye (Zach, ALL MY CHILDREN) will be blogging again along with Dave Annable (Justin, BROTHERS & SISTERS), William Fichtner (ex-Josh, AS THE WORLD TURNS) and several others.

Woman charged with child neglect in death of 3-year-old
A 39-year-old Madison woman was charged Tuesday with child neglect resulting in the February death of her 3-year-old grandchild from an overdose of the prescription painkiller oxycodone. According to a criminal complaint, April M. Walker, did not seek help for nearly six hours after the child could not be awakened.

Instead of going to the hospital, Walker drove two YWCA residents to the Job Center, saying she was then going to the emergency room. But Walker went to her mother’s house, watched THE YOUNG AND THE RESTLESS then made calls about Amaya, eventually speaking with a nurse at a clinic. Walker then left to get a friend and returned to find Amaya wasn’t breathing. The friend called 911 just after 1 p.m. Amaya died the next day

3-D Network coming soon
The seeds of the nation's first 3-D broadcast network have been planted, repping a small step for television, but a giant leap for 3-D. Signet Intl. Holdings, a publicly traded company led by former NBC and PBS exec Tom Donaldson and boxing promoter Ernie Letiziano, is buying AMG TV, a modestly sized net that feeds syndicated programs to some 200 terrestrial station affiliates, some of them carrying programming only part of the day.
